Kendle

A gentler variant of Kendall, Kendle combines the Ken- root with an -dle suffix that softens the overall sound. The name evokes both outdoor imagery (similar to 'kindle') and has a slightly vintage, bookish charm. It's well-suited for parents seeking something recognizable yet distinctive.

Related to Kendall, which historically refers to a place in England known for cloth production.
